What is Video Editing Software?

Simply put, video editing software allows you to manipulate and enhance video footage by cutting, trimming, adding effects, and incorporating audio. Think of it as your digital canvas—where raw footage transforms into a compelling story.

From simple edits like cropping and merging clips to complex effects like green screen and color grading, video editing tools make it all possible. While premium software like Adobe Premiere Pro and Final Cut Pro dominates the industry, free alternatives have come a long way, offering impressive functionality without breaking the bank.

12 Best Free Video Editing Software Options

1. DaVinci Resolve

Best for: Professional-grade color correction and high-quality post-production.

2. Lightworks

Best for: Professional video editing with an intuitive interface and Hollywood-level quality.

3. HitFilm Express

Best for: VFX-heavy projects with advanced motion graphics capabilities.

4. Shotcut

Best for: Open-source enthusiasts who want a fully customizable interface.

5. OpenShot

Best for: Beginners who need a simple yet powerful editor with drag-and-drop features.

6. VideoPad

Best for: Home users and YouTubers looking for an easy-to-learn editing software.

7. VSDC Free Video Editor

Best for: Windows users who need advanced features like motion tracking and masking.

8. Kdenlive

Best for: Linux users seeking a non-linear video editor with pro features.

9. Blender

Best for: 3D animation and video editing combined in one tool.

10. Avid Media Composer First

Best for: Aspiring filmmakers who want a taste of professional editing software.

11. iMovie

Best for: Mac users who need a sleek, easy-to-use editor with built-in templates.

12. Kapwing

Best for: Online content creators who prefer a browser-based editor with collaborative features.

How to Choose the Best Free Video Editing Software

With so many options available, picking the right video editing software can feel overwhelming. Here are a few key factors to consider:

  • Your Experience Level – Beginners might prefer OpenShot, while advanced users may opt for DaVinci Resolve.
  • Your Editing Needs – Need VFX? Try HitFilm Express. Want simple editing? VideoPad is a great choice.
  • Compatibility – Ensure the software works on your operating system.
  • Export Options – Check if the editor supports HD and 4K exports for high-quality videos.

Top Tips for Efficient Video Editing

  1. Plan Before You Edit – Outline your video’s structure to streamline the process.
  2. Use Keyboard Shortcuts – Speed up editing with built-in hotkeys.
  3. Optimize Your Footage – Reduce lag by using proxy files when working with high-resolution videos.
  4. Experiment with Effects – Try transitions, color grading, and slow-motion to make your videos more engaging.
  5. Keep It Simple – Avoid overloading your videos with unnecessary effects.
